According to the State Statistics Service of Ukraine, the total number of people employed by the Ukrainian coal industry was 122 000 as of 1 January 2016, including 51 000 at state-owned mines. According to the Ministry of Energy and Coal Industry, coal production in Ukraine dropped by 38.8% in 2015 to 39.7 million tonnes.

The accident underlined the messy state of Ukraine's coal industry. Equipment is outdated and treacherous, and most of Ukraine's more than 400,000 coal workers do not receive their wages on time. Much of eastern Ukraine, once proud of its coal riches, has turned into a wasteland of poverty and environmental destruction.

Coal mining is an important industry in Ukraine.. Coal mining in Ukraine is often associated with coal-rich Donets basin.However this is not the only coal mining region, other being Lviv-Volhynian basin and Dnieper brown coal mining basin.
Donets Basin [Донецький вугільний басейн; Donetskyi vuhilnyi basein] (also known as the Donets Coal Basin, Donbas, or Donets region). The most important fuel source and industrial region of Ukraine and of all Eastern Europe, the location of highly developed coal industry, ferrous-metallurgy industry, machine building, chemical industry, and construction industry ...
